Abstract

We present measurements of the longitudinal spin asymmetry, ALLA_{LL}, for the inclusive jet signal at STAR. The data presented here are mid-rapidity jets in the transverse momentum range of 5<pT<355<pT<35 GeV/c and come from polarized proton-proton collisions at center of mass energies of s=200\sqrt{s}=200 GeV. We compare our measured ALLA_{LL} values to predictions derived from various parameterizations of the polarized gluon distribution function. The results are shown to provide significant constraints for allowable gluon parameterizations within the measurement's kinematic Bjorken-x range of 0.03<x<0.30.03<x<0.3.
